4.2.21 Jump frequency function
The jump frequency function allows you to operate the inverter so
that it avoids the resonant frequency of the machine driven by the
same.
Since the inverter avoids the motor operation with a constant output
frequency within the specified range of the frequencies to jump when
the jump frequency function is enabled, you cannot set any inverter
output frequency within the specified range of the frequencies to
jump.
Note that, while the inverter is accelerating or decelerating the motor, the inverter output frequency
changes continuously according to the set acceleration/deceleration time.
You can set up to three frequencies to jump.

4.2.22 Acceleration stop frequency setting
The acceleration stop frequency setting function allows you to make
the inverter wait, upon starting the motor, until the slipping of the
motor becomes less when the load on the motor causes a large
moment of inertia.
Use this function if the inverter has tripped because of overcurrent when starting the motor.
This function can operate with every acceleration pattern, regardless of the setting of the acceleration
curve selection (A097).
